Important Precautions

Pre- and post-procedure precautions. Review carefully for safe and effective results.

Consultation RequiredWhen combining with laser or other treatments, decide after consultation with medical staff.
Post-Treatment Sun ProtectionAvoid strong UV exposure for 1 week after treatment and apply SPF 50+ sunscreen thoroughly when outdoors. This is essential to prevent pigmentation and delayed recovery from irritation.
Enhanced Moisturizing and Soothing CareThe skin barrier may temporarily weaken after treatment, requiring thorough moisturizing and soothing care. Avoid irritating products containing alcohol or fragrance for 1 week.
Avoid Exfoliation ProductsAvoid exfoliating cosmetics, AHA/BHA peels, and physical scrubs for 1 week after treatment. Cumulative irritation on recovering skin can cause inflammation and pigmentation.
Avoid Alcohol and Vigorous ExerciseAvoid alcohol, vigorous exercise, saunas, and high-temperature environments for 24 to 48 hours after treatment. Increased blood flow and body temperature can worsen swelling and inflammation.
Follow Recommended Treatment IntervalsPlease follow the recommended 2 to 4 week interval. Excessive repeat treatments at short intervals can cause cumulative skin burden and reduce recovery capacity.
